Hand Hygiene

Hand Hygiene - What it is

Hands easily collect and spread germs that make us sick, and are the main causes of cross-contamination.

Why do I need to perform hand hygiene?

Performing hand hygiene frequently can prevent you and your loved ones from being infected.

When should I perform hand hygiene?
  • Before and after any physical contact with patients
  • Before you leave the patient care area
  • Before and after eating
  • After visiting the toilets
What do I use for hand hygiene?

Soap and water, or alcohol antiseptics.

How to perform proper hand hygiene?

Cover all surfaces of your hands, includin
  • Front and back of palm
  • Wrists
  • Fingers, thumbs and fingertips
Rinse the soap with water, and dry with paper towel.
When using alcohol antiseptics, rub until dry and do not rinse.
